Abstract :
Abstract—The rising threat of DoS, and DDoS has made IP Traceback an important problem. Instead of preventing systems, we have to deploy mechanism to actually trace the culprit. In this way the attackers will be discouraged. People are working on mechanisms to defend against DDoS. We need mechanisms which are easy to deploy and which require less manegement work. In this report, we discuss the current scenario of IP Traceback mechanisms. We make a simple matrix on which we analyze different mechanisms.
